David hit rock bottom when he and his army returned to Ziklag to find their home destroyed and their families taken captive. After David sought the Lord, though, he and his men defeated the enemy, rescued their loved ones, and recovered everything that had been taken. Alistair Begg examines how a “chance” encounter with an Egyptian servant led to David’s triumph, which he graciously shared, foreshadowing the eternal victory only King Jesus is able to secure.
